2031001253 has 2 divisors, whose sum is σ = 2031001254. Its totient is φ = 2031001252.
The previous prime is 2031001243. The next prime is 2031001307. The reversal of 2031001253 is 3521001302.
It is a weak prime.
It can be written as a sum of positive squares in only one way, i.e., 1698923524 + 332077729 = 41218^2 + 18223^2 .
It is a cyclic number.
It is not a de Polignac number, because 2031001253 - 210 = 2031000229 is a prime.
It is a congruent number.
It is not a weakly prime, because it can be changed into another prime (2031001243) by changing a digit.
It is a pernicious number, because its binary representation contains a prime number (17) of ones.
It is a polite number, since it can be written as a sum of consecutive naturals, namely, 1015500626 + 1015500627.
It is an arithmetic number, because the mean of its divisors is an integer number (1015500627).
Almost surely, 22031001253 is an apocalyptic number.
It is an amenable number.
2031001253 is a deficient number, since it is larger than the sum of its proper divisors (1).
2031001253 is an equidigital number, since it uses as much as digits as its factorization.
2031001253 is an odious number, because the sum of its binary digits is odd.
The product of its (nonzero) digits is 180, while the sum is 17.
The square root of 2031001253 is about 45066.6312586153. The cubic root of 2031001253 is about 1266.3975561803.
Adding to 2031001253 its reverse (3521001302), we get a palindrome (5552002555).
The spelling of 2031001253 in words is "two billion, thirty-one million, one thousand, two hundred fifty-three".
